The need for more than one series of footnotes is common in critical
editions (and other literary criticism), but occasionally arises in
other areas.
Of course, the canonical critical edition package,
edmac,
offers the facility, as does its LaTeX port, the
ledmac
package.
Multiple ranges of footnotes are offered to LaTeX users by the
manyfoot package. The package provides a fair array of
presentation options, as well. Another critical edition
ednotes package is built upon a basis that includes
manyfoot, as its mechanism for multiple sets of footnotes.
The
bigfoot package also uses
manyfoot as part of
its highly sophisticated structure of footnote facilities, which was
also designed to support typesetting critical editions.
